CLAT is a very Tough exam and every year around 80000 students Compete to get admission in Top 92 Law Colleges in India.
You need to start Preparation as soon as you complete your exam for 12th. The Course is divided into Six Parts namely:
- Legal Aptitude
- Indian Constitution
- English
- Mathematics
- Logical Reasoning
- General Knowledge
The Course Require at least 3 months to be Complete fully. It will require more time if you are New to some Topics. You should Better Buy a Guide Book. Even I applied For CLAT. I had a Guide Book of Arihant Self Study Guide.
You should Better Get a Tuition for some subjects like Logical Reasoning and Maths( If you are from Arts).
